1. Elevate Materials: Use Urban-Inspired, High-Performance Fabrics
Streetwear thrives on innovative materials like neoprene, mesh, denim, reflective vinyl, and technical fabrics such as Gore-Tex. Applying these textiles to household items enhances durability and urban appeal.
- Examples: Oven mitts crafted from heat-resistant neoprene with graffiti or mural prints; throw pillows or chairs upholstered in Cordura fabric featuring utility loops mimicking tactical gear.

2. Introduce Multifunctional and Modular Designs Reflecting Streetwear Layering
Streetwear’s adaptability through layering inspires household items with modularity and customization.
- Ideas: Coffee tables with interchangeable graphic panels revealing hidden compartments; wall organizers designed like cargo pants with detachable pockets.

5. Embed Tactical and Utility Features for Practical, Rugged Style
Tactical streetwear elements—carabiners, MOLLE webbing, utility straps—infuse household goods with enhanced function and edgy design.
- Product Ideas: Kitchen organizers with detachable pouches; shower curtains outfitted with MOLLE loops; modular lighting with adjustable straps.
